Biological Background: T-lymphocyte activation antigen CD86 Function and Localization
- CD86 (also known as B7-2, ETC-1, Ly-58, and CD28 ligand 2) is a member of the immunoglobulin superfamily and a key costimulatory molecule.
- Functions as a ligand for the CD28 receptor, providing an essential secondary signal that augments MHC/TCR-mediated activation of naive T-cells.
- Acts as an inhibitor of T-cell activation by binding to CTLA4, a decoy receptor that blocks CD28-mediated T-cell priming. Related references: PMID:7504059, PMID:7513726
- Regulates B-cell function by controlling IgG1 production and activating the NF-kappa-B pathway upon CD40 engagement. Related references: PMID:23241883
- Localizes to the cell membrane and is expressed on the surface of antigen-presenting cells.
- Post-translational modifications include glycosylation and disulfide bond formation; also undergoes ubiquitination.
- Alternative splicing produces multiple isoforms, contributing to functional diversity.
Experimental Guidance and Technical Tips
- The immunogen corresponds to the extracellular domain (aa 24–245), ensuring recognition of the native conformation for flow cytometry.
- For flow cytometry, titrate the PE-conjugated antibody to determine the optimal staining concentration and include an Fc-blocking step to reduce non-specific binding.
- Use appropriate viability dyes and gates to exclude dead cells during acquisition.
- Validate staining in the relevant sample system (e.g., mouse splenocytes or antigen-presenting cell lines) and include isotype controls.
